    Brake fluid should not get low unless there is a leak somewhere.

    • @1leftadventures258
      @1leftadventures258  2 ปีที่แล้ว +2

      Yep. You’re correct. As long as you have new pads. As the pads wear, it takes more fluid to push through the calipers and engage the pads. The thinner the pads, the more fluid is needed. So if you add fluid to get the most of your pads, it’ll be too much when you replace them.
